编程刷题用什么软件好些呢
-
编程刷题是提升编程能力和算法理解的重要方式之一。选择合适的软件工具可以提高刷题效率和体验。下面我将介绍几个常用的编程刷题软件,供您选择:
-
Topcoder(https://www.topcoder.com/):Topcoder是一个知名的在线编程竞赛平台,提供各种编程题目和竞赛活动。它拥有丰富的算法题库和强大的编程社区,可以帮助用户提升算法和编程能力。
以上是几个常用的编程刷题软件,每个软件都有其特点和适用范围。您可以根据自己的需求和喜好选择适合自己的软件进行刷题。刷题不仅可以提高编程能力,还可以增加解决问题的思维能力,帮助您在编程领域取得更好的成绩。
1年前 -
编程刷题时,有许多不同的软件和工具可供选择。以下是一些常用的编程刷题软件和工具:
-
LeetCode(力扣):LeetCode是一个非常受欢迎的在线编程刷题平台,提供了大量的算法和数据结构题目。它有一个用户友好的界面,可以直接在网页上编写和运行代码,并提供了丰富的测试用例和解题讨论。
-
HackerRank:HackerRank是另一个流行的在线编程刷题平台,提供了各种类型的编程题目,包括算法、数据结构、数据库和人工智能等。它还有一个竞赛功能,可以与其他用户进行比赛。
-
CodeSignal:CodeSignal是一个专注于技术面试准备的平台,提供了大量的编程题目和面试模拟环境。它还有一个独特的功能,即通过评估用户的编码技能和表现来生成技能报告和推荐。
-
Codewars:Codewars是一个以社区驱动的编程刷题平台,用户可以挑战和解决其他用户创建的编程题目。它提供了不同难度级别的题目,并有一个评分系统来评估用户的编程技能。
-
Project Euler:Project Euler是一个专注于数学和计算问题的编程刷题平台,题目涉及数论、组合数学、图论等。它的题目通常具有较高的难度,适合那些对数学和算法有较强兴趣的人。
除了以上提到的在线平台,还有一些本地开发环境和编辑器可以用于编程刷题,如Visual Studio Code、PyCharm、Eclipse等。这些工具提供了丰富的功能和插件,可以提高编码效率和调试能力。
选择适合自己的编程刷题软件和工具主要取决于个人的偏好和需求。可以根据平台的题目类型、界面友好度、社区活跃度等因素进行评估和选择。此外,也可以尝试不同的平台和工具,找到适合自己的方式来刷题。
1年前 -
-
编程刷题是提高编程能力和解决问题的有效方法之一。在选择编程刷题软件时,可以考虑以下几个方面:
除了以上几个知名的编程刷题平台,还有很多其他的平台可供选择,如Topcoder、Project Euler、AtCoder等。选择合适的编程刷题软件,可以根据自己的目标、编程语言偏好和题目类型等因素进行考虑。此外,可以参考其他开发者的评价和推荐,选择适合自己的平台和题目。无论选择哪个平台,坚持刷题并不断学习和思考,才能提高编程能力。
1年前